On 8/19/21 9:18 PM, Bas Couwenberg wrote:
> Your package FTBFS with GDAL 3.3.1:
> 
>  10/20 Test #12: test-invalid-self-intersection-on-open-ring ..............***Failed    0.26 sec
>  + /build/osmcoastline-2.3.0/obj-x86_64-linux-gnu/src/nodegrid2opl
>  + cat
>  + /build/osmcoastline-2.3.0/obj-x86_64-linux-gnu/src/osmcoastline --verbose --overwrite --output-database=/build/osmcoastline-2.3.0/obj-x86_64-linux-gnu/test/invalid-self-intersection-on-open-ring.db /build/osmcoastline-2.3.0/obj-x86_64-linux-gnu/test/invalid-self-intersection-on-open-ring.opl
>  + RC=2
>  + set -e
>  + test 2 -eq 2
>  + grep Self-intersection at or near point /build/osmcoastline-2.3.0/obj-x86_64-linux-gnu/test/invalid-self-intersection-on-open-ring.log
>  Warning 1: Self-intersection at or near point 1.0900000000000001 1.9749999999999999
>  + grep ^There were 2 warnings.$ /build/osmcoastline-2.3.0/obj-x86_64-linux-gnu/test/invalid-self-intersection-on-open-ring.log

This test also fails with GDAL 3.2.2 in unstable, it seems to be caused
by the recent update of GEOS to 3.9.1.

The issue has been forwarded upstream.
